Located in the Northern Panhandle of West Virginia, Wheeling is a vibrant city situated along the foothills of the Appalachian Mountains and along the Ohio River. Historically significant, it was a major hub in the American industrial revolution and today it continues to have a strong presence in industries such as steel, healthcare, education, and energy production. Wheeling’s geographical location is instrumental in its significance for LTL freight shipping. The city’s location along the Ohio River provides a natural transportation route, and it is also intersected by major highways like Interstate 70 and U.S. Route 40, creating easy connectivity to other significant logistic centers.The city is also in close proximity to several major cities, including Pittsburgh, PA; Columbus, OH; and Cleveland, OH. This makes it an attractive transit point where companies can consolidate less than truckload (LTL) shipments. Furthermore, Wheeling boasts a well-developed rail network, being a historical railroad city, reiterating the city’s strength for freight forwarding. Thus, companies looking for LTL freight shipping out of Wheeling, WV will find an expansive network of highways, railways, and waterways that provide quick, efficient, and affordable access to major markets.
Wheeling is a city in the U.S. state of West Virginia. Located almost entirely in Ohio County, of which it is the county seat, it lies along the Ohio River in the foothills of the Appalachian Mountains and also contains a tiny portion extending into Marshall County. Wheeling is located about 60 miles (96 km) west of Pittsburgh and is the principal city of the Wheeling metropolitan area. As of the 2020 census, the city had a population of 27,062, and the metro area had a population of 139,513. It is the fifth-largest city in West Virginia, and the largest in the state’s Northern Panhandle.
Wheeling was originally a settlement in the British colony of Virginia, and later the second-largest city in the Commonwealth of Virginia. During the American Civil War, Wheeling was the host of the Wheeling Conventions that led to the formation of West Virginia, and it was the first capital of the new state. Due to its location along major transportation routes, including the Ohio River, National Road, and the B&O Railroad, Wheeling became a manufacturing center in the late nineteenth century. After the closing of factories and substantial population loss following World War II, Wheeling’s major industries now include healthcare, education, law and legal services, entertainment and tourism, and energy.
From the acceptance of the new state of West Virginia into the union on June 20, 1863, until the Restored Government of Virginia’s move to Alexandria in August of the same year, Wheeling was the state capital of both West Virginia and Virginia.

Wheeling Less Than Truck Load (LTL) Freight Team Drivers & Accessorials
LTL freight also offers team drivers and accessorials to help move and secure your load. Drivers are limited by law (HOS – hours of service) how many hours or miles they can drive in a single day. If you need your LTL shipment moved faster, team driver options provide a way to double the output and cut the delivery times in half. Accessorials also help ensure that your load has the attention it needs. From tarps and tie-downs to specific driver based requirements; LTL Freight has options to help ensure your freight has the best possible journey.
